Barbed wire first phase of wall relocation in Bil`inMa`an News - When the 709-kilometer barrier is complete, 85 percent of it will have been built inside the occupied West Bank, cutting at times as many as 22 kilometers into the occupied land. 23/6/2011

Gisha appeals a judgment that violates Gazan Muslims` freedom of worship Nomi Heger - Gisha - Despite PM`s Netanyahu`s boast that "Jerusalem is open to beleivers of all religions", Gazan Muslims are completely denied access to their holy sites there. An appeal lodges by Gisha on behalf of sever Muslim women from Gaza was denied by Justice Eliyahu Bitan of the Beer Sheva District Court, who imposed a punitive sum of 25,000 Sheles in "court expenses" with the clear purpose of discouraging further such appeals. Gisha is now appealing to the Supreme Court to reverse this ruling. 21/6/2011
